County of Los Angeles The mpox virus is in the same family of viruses as variola, the virus that causes smallpox. Look like bumps, pimples, blisters, or scabs and will go through several stages before healing. Health officials believe this is currently the most common way that monkeypox is spreading in the U.S. Touching objects, fabrics (clothing, bedding, or towels) and surfaces that have been used by someone with monkeypox. People living with uncontrolled or advanced HIV are at high risk for becoming severely ill if they get mpox. For those with especially sensitive lesions, patients can talk to their doctor about how to best manage the pain, whether that be something over-the-counter, like Tylenol, or stronger prescription pain medication, Dr. Schaffner said. According to the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C), past data shows that the smallpox vaccine could be around 85% effective in preventing monkeypox, although these numbers are estimates. Rest and home remedies including sitz baths, topical Vaseline, antihistamines (Benadryl) for itching, and pain medications, such as acetaminophen (Tylenol) or ibuprofen (Advil), may be all you need to recover. It is unknown whether pregnant people are more susceptible to monkeypox virus or whether infection is more severe in pregnancy. Wiley Statsref: Statistics Reference Online. This is because there is more and more evidence that mpox infection can be more severe for people living with HIV who have low CD4 counts (<350 cells/ml) or an unsuppressed viral load. Mpox symptoms usually start within 3 weeks of exposure to the virus. Younger children are at risk of getting mpox if they live with someone who has mpox, especially if there is any skin-to-skin contact with the infected person. Avoid very close, intimate contact with someone with mpox symptoms, especially: Oral, anal, and vaginal sex, or touching the genitals or anus, Hugging, cuddling, massaging, and/or kissing, Skin-to-skin contact with the rash on their body.
